Wanting to learn to roll on NES controller on pc, anyone know if these would be suitable? by poppy_longjaws_3rd in Tetris

[–]foreigner_666 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I have gone through at least 6 of those crappy £10 nes USB controllers, they might work for a few weeks but if you want to learn properly by far the best way is to get actual hardware, unfortunately. It’s a false economy and you’ll end up wasting more money buying those ones to learn for a couple weeks and still won’t be able to play in proper tournaments (except the few that allow emulators like CTW iirc)
